WitrynaKhudabadi (देवदेन/ Devden) was a script used to write the Sindhi language, generally used by some Sindhi Hindus even in the present-day. The script originates from Khudabad, a city in Sindh, and is named after it.It is also known as Hathvanki (or Warangi) script. Witryna18 mar 2015 · Sindhi language. 1. SINDHI LANGUAGE By: SAQIB IQBAL ROLL NO. : D-14-CS-07. 2. INTODUCTION • Sindhi language evolved over a period of 2400 years. The language of the people of Sindh, after coming in contact with the Aryan, became Indo-Aryan (Prakrit). Sindhi was one of the first Indo-Aryan languages to encounter influence from Persian and Arabic following the Umayyad conquest in 712 CE.
